The median sold price in Millers Croft is £320,000, based on 34 sales recorded by HM Land Registry.
Over the past decade prices in Millers Croft are +95% in cash terms, and +40% after adjusting for inflation (ONS CPIH).
The median is £2,238 per square metre, from EPC floor-area records.
Figures update monthly from HM Land Registry. The most recent sale here was recorded on 15 May 2026; the latest two months may be incomplete while sales register.
